maximecb
PhD in compiler design. Also having fun with graphics, machine learning, electronics, music and DIY. All opinions are my own.
Montreal, Canada
Pinned Repositories
Minigrid
Simple and easily configurable grid world environments for reinforcement learning
kavascript
Minimalistic dynamically-typed programming language for didactic purposes.
MusicToy
MusicToy is a minimalist grid sequencer designed to make composition simple and encourage experimentation. It uses the HTML5 web audio and canvas APIs.
noisecraft
Browser-based visual programming language and platform for sound synthesis.
toyCPU
Assembly Programming Learning Platform
Turing-Drawings
Randomly generated Turing machines draw images and animations on a 2D canvas.
Turing-Tunes
Procedural music generation engine using Turing machines.
uvm
Fun, portable, minimalistic virtual machine.
ruby
The Ruby Programming Language
yjit
Optimizing JIT compiler built inside CRuby
maximecb's Repositories
maximecb/noisecraft
Browser-based visual programming language and platform for sound synthesis.
maximecb/uvm
Fun, portable, minimalistic virtual machine.
maximecb/Turing-Drawings
Randomly generated Turing machines draw images and animations on a 2D canvas.
maximecb/Turing-Tunes
Procedural music generation engine using Turing machines.
maximecb/MusicToy
MusicToy is a minimalist grid sequencer designed to make composition simple and encourage experimentation. It uses the HTML5 web audio and canvas APIs.
maximecb/kavascript
Minimalistic dynamically-typed programming language for didactic purposes.
maximecb/toyCPU
Assembly Programming Learning Platform
maximecb/Melodique
Algorithmic musical phrase generator
maximecb/AVR-Annoyance
Device using an Atmel microcontroller to produce high-pitched screechy noises at random, unpredictable intervals.
maximecb/Gradient
A JavaScript/HTML5 artificial life experiment involving agents that live in a 2D grid world.
maximecb/pyopendmx
Python OpenDMX stage light control
maximecb/CodeBeats
Online music programming / live coding platform
maximecb/acidlines
Step sequencer for 303-clones (and mono synths in general) based on the Web MIDI API
maximecb/AVR-Alarm-Clock
Source code for an avr-based alarm clock
maximecb/party-anims
Visuals and animations I created for parties
maximecb/Miniworld
Simple and easily configurable 3D FPS-game-like environments for reinforcement learning
maximecb/pgw
maximecb/weebasic
weebasic
maximecb/plush
Minimalistic dynamically-typed programming language for fun/teaching purposes.
maximecb/zmq-cam
Simple camera server using OpenCV and ZMQ
maximecb/gym-duckietown
Self-driving car simulator for the Duckietown universe
maximecb/ledburn
Awesome LED Cube Project
maximecb/minibot-iface
Remote control interface for the MiniWorld robot (Raspberry Pi)
maximecb/ruby-build
Compile and install Ruby
maximecb/ruby
The Ruby Programming Language [mirror]